Effective SEO for workers compensation lawyers includes several key components:
- Keyword Research: Identify the specific terms and phrases potential clients are using to search for services. For instance, terms like "Tampa workers comp attorney" or "best workers compensation lawyer in Tampa" can help you focus your content.
- On-Page Optimization: Ensure that your website's pages are optimized for these keywords. This includes incorporating keywords into title tags, meta descriptions, header tags, and throughout the content while maintaining natural readability.
- Local SEO: Workers compensation cases are often location-specific. Optimize your Google My Business listing and ensure your firm appears in local search results by using location-based keywords, such as "workers compensation lawyers in Tampa Heights."
- Content Creation: Regularly publish high-quality, informative content that addresses common questions and concerns related to workers compensation law. Blog posts on topics like "What to Do After a Workplace Injury" or "Understanding Your Rights Under Florida Workers Compensation Law" can position you as an authority in your field.
- Backlinks: Building backlinks from reputable sites can enhance your site's authority. Consider guest blogging on legal websites or collaborating with local businesses to create mutually beneficial content.

Understanding Your Target Audience
Before diving into SEO strategies, it’s crucial to understand who your target audience is. In Tampa, the demographics of clients seeking workers compensation lawyers can vary widely. From small business owners in SoHo to employees in larger corporations in St. Petersburg, each group has unique needs and search behaviors.
To effectively reach and engage your target audience, consider the following key demographics and their specific needs:
- Small Business Owners: This group often seeks information on how to protect their business from workplace injuries and liabilities. They may search for terms like "workers compensation insurance for small businesses" or "how to reduce workplace accidents." Creating content around workplace safety guidelines, legal obligations, and best practices for injury prevention can resonate well with them. You could also host webinars or write blog posts that discuss the importance of risk assessments and employee training, which will position your firm as a knowledgeable partner in their business journey.
- Corporate Employees: Workers in larger companies might be more focused on understanding their rights and the claims process. They often look for guidance on "how to file a workers compensation claim" or "workers compensation rights in Florida." Providing clear, step-by-step guides and FAQs can help demystify the process for them. Additionally, consider creating video content that visually explains the claims process, as this can enhance understanding and engagement. Highlighting success stories or case studies can also showcase your firm’s effectiveness in helping clients navigate these situations.
- Injured Workers: Individuals who have recently suffered an injury at work are in urgent need of assistance. They are likely searching for immediate help, using phrases like "workers compensation lawyer near me" or "what to do after a work injury." Ensure that your website has a user-friendly interface with easily accessible contact information and resources that provide urgent support. Offering a live chat feature or a dedicated hotline can provide immediate assistance, making it easier for potential clients to reach out for help when they need it most.
- Family Members of Injured Workers: Often, family members look for information on behalf of their loved ones. They may be searching for terms like "how to help a family member file a workers compensation claim." Addressing this audience with compassionate, informative content can build trust and position your firm as a reliable source of support. Consider creating a dedicated section on your website for family members that includes resources, checklists, and guides that help them understand how they can assist their loved ones through the claims process.

Essential SEO Strategies for Workers Compensation Lawyers
To enhance your online presence and attract more clients, consider the following essential SEO strategies tailored for workers compensation lawyers in Tampa:
1. Optimize Your Website for Local Search
Local SEO is crucial for workers compensation lawyers aiming to attract clients in specific areas like Sunset Park and Tampa Heights. Here are some steps to optimize your website:
- Include Local Keywords: Use keywords that reflect your location and services. Phrases like “workers compensation lawyer in Tampa” or “Tampa workers compensation attorney” can help your site rank better in local searches.
- Create Location-Specific Pages: If you serve multiple neighborhoods, consider creating dedicated pages for each location. This helps you target specific audiences and improves your chances of appearing in local search results.
- Utilize Google My Business: Ensure your Google My Business profile is complete and optimized. This is especially important for local visibility and helps your firm appear in local pack results.
2. Develop High-Quality, Relevant Content
Content is king in the world of SEO. For workers compensation lawyers, creating informative and engaging content is vital. Here’s how you can approach this:
- Blog Posts: Regularly publish blog posts addressing common questions and concerns related to workers compensation. Topics could include “What to Do After a Workplace Injury” or “Understanding Your Rights as an Employee in Tampa.”
- Case Studies: Share success stories (with client permission) that highlight your expertise in handling workers compensation cases. This not only builds trust but also showcases your capabilities.
- Videos and Webinars: Consider creating video content or hosting webinars to discuss important topics in workers compensation law. This can engage visitors and keep them on your site longer.
3. Build Quality Backlinks
Backlinks are an essential part of SEO that can significantly boost your site’s authority. Here are ways to build quality backlinks:
- Guest Blogging: Write guest posts for reputable legal websites or local Tampa blogs. This can help you reach a wider audience and gain valuable backlinks.
- Local Partnerships: Collaborate with local businesses or organizations related to occupational safety or employee rights. This can lead to mutual backlinks and increased visibility.
- Press Releases: If you have newsworthy updates (like community involvement or awards), consider sending out press releases to local media outlets. This can create buzz and attract backlinks.
4. Utilize Social Media for Engagement
Social media platforms are not just for promotion; they are also excellent tools for engaging with your audience. For Tampa workers compensation lawyers, platforms like Facebook and LinkedIn can be particularly effective:
- Share Content: Regularly share your blog posts, articles, and other content on your social media channels to drive traffic back to your website.
- Engage with the Community: Participate in local discussions, share local news related to workers compensation, and engage with followers by responding to comments and messages.
- Run Targeted Ads: Consider using paid social media advertising to target specific demographics within Tampa. This can help you reach individuals who may be seeking legal assistance.
5. Monitor and Analyze Your SEO Performance
Implementing SEO strategies is just the beginning; you must also monitor your performance to understand what works and what doesn’t. T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console can provide valuable insights into your website’s traffic and engagement.
Pay attention to metrics such as:
- Organic Traffic: Monitor how much traffic is coming from search engines to gauge the effectiveness of your SEO efforts.
- Keyword Rankings: Track the performance of your targeted keywords to see if you are climbing the search rankings.
- Conversion Rates: Analyze how many visitors are converting into leads or clients. This will help you refine your approach and focus on what drives results.
Local SEO Considerations for Workers Compensation Lawyers in Tampa
Local SEO is particularly important for lawyers since most clients prefer to hire someone from their area. Here are additional local strategies to consider:
1. Leverage Local Directories
Ensure your law firm is listed in local directories that cater to legal services. Websites like Avvo, FindLaw, and Justia can help boost your visibility and credibility. Make sure your information is consistent across all platforms, including your website, Google My Business, and any directories you join.
2. Encourage Client Reviews
Online reviews can significantly impact your firm’s reputation and visibility. Encourage satisfied clients to leave positive reviews on your Google My Business profile and other review sites. Responding to reviews, both positive and negative, shows potential clients that you value their feedback and are committed to excellent service.
3. Participate in Local Events
Being active in your local community can enhance your visibility and reputation. Consider sponsoring local events, participating in community service, or hosting workshops on workers compensation rights. This not only establishes your authority but can also lead to valuable networking opportunities.
